Our Trust Litigation Case Process
1. Case Evaluation
We begin with a full review of the trust, will, financial records, and family history. Our legal team will identify your rights, deadlines, and the best legal path before anything is filed.
2. Court Filings
The case formally begins when a probate petition or trust lawsuit is filed in California probate court, often in Orange County Superior Court. This step sets the legal issues, brings all parties into the case.
3. Discovery and Settlement
Both sides exchange documents, take depositions, and file motions to address disputes. Many trust and probate cases resolve here through settlement discussions or court ordered mediation.
4. Trial and Resolution
If no agreement is reached, the case proceeds to trial before a probate judge. After a ruling, the court orders distributions, removals of fiduciaries, or financial recovery, and we handle enforcement or appeals if needed.

An Interesting Fact About Trust Litigation in Laguna Niguel
A lesser-known but important aspect of trust litigation in Laguna Niguel, California, is the state law requiring trustees to provide a mandatory notice to beneficiaries within 60 days of a trust becoming irrevocable. This notification, mandated by California Probate Code Section 16061.7, starts the clock for beneficiaries to contest the trust, typically only allowing 120 days to object. Failing to provide proper notice can extend the timeframe for litigation and significantly impact trust administration in Laguna Niguel.
Overview of Trust Litigation Laws in Laguna Niguel
Trust litigation in Laguna Niguel is shaped by California's comprehensive trust and probate statutes, which establish clear guidelines for the creation, administration, and contesting of trusts. As detailed by Max Alavi, Attorney at Law, trust disputes often arise from concerns such as breach of fiduciary duty, undue influence, improper trustee actions, or ambiguity in the trust's terms. Local regulations require trustees to act in the best interests of beneficiaries, file annual reports, and maintain transparency regarding trust assets. If a beneficiary or other interested party believes a trustee has failed in these duties or the trust document is invalid, they may initiate litigation through the Orange County court system, which commonly oversees such matters in the Laguna Niguel area.
- Trust litigation may address issues like mismanagement of assets, disputes over distribution, or allegations of fraud or undue influence.
- Potential penalties for trustees found at fault include removal, personal liability for losses, or compelled restitution to the trust.
- Court processes can range from informal mediation and negotiations to formal hearings and trials, depending on the case's complexity and the parties' willingness to resolve conflicts.

Laguna Niguel Probate Court System
Probate and trust litigation matters for residents of Laguna Niguel are administered by the Superior Court of California, County of Orange. The probate division is responsible for overseeing legal processes involving decedents’ estates, wills, trusts, conservatorships, adult and minor guardianships, and elder protection matters.
- Key Court: Superior Court of California, County of Orange – Probate/Mental Health Division.
- Main location: Central Justice Center, Santa Ana; select probate functions also at the Costa Mesa Justice Complex.
- Cases are filed and heard at designated divisions depending on the nature of the proceeding.
- Case Types Handled:
- Probate of decedents’ estates
- Trust litigation, including trust contests, breach of fiduciary duty, and accounting disputes
- Guardianships of minors (person and estate)
- Conservatorships (protecting incapacitated adults or elders)
- Disputes among heirs, beneficiaries, or fiduciaries
- Will contests, spousal property petitions, and modifications of trusts
- Unique Features:
- Orange County provides dedicated probate examiners, mediation services, and an online case access portal for probate and trust proceedings.
- Local rules specify notice requirements, mandatory forms, and case management practices tailored to probate and trust matters.
- For Laguna Niguel clients, initial filings and most hearings take place at the county level, but some remote appearances and e-filing options are available.
Probate and trust litigation practitioners serving Laguna Niguel must adhere to both statewide California Probate Code and the Local Rules of the Superior Court of Orange County. Legal clients can expect comprehensive oversight, formal procedures for disputes, and access to resources designed for document submissions, hearings, and mediation.
